Digitale electronica en processoren Digitale electronica en ...
Digitale electronica en processoren Digitale electronica en ...
Digitale electronica en processoren Digitale electronica en ...
Create successful ePaper yourself
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.
Wanneer er meer dan 4 variabel<strong>en</strong> zijn, ligg<strong>en</strong> alle bur<strong>en</strong> niet meer fysisch fysisch fysisch naast naast elkaar elkaar. elkaar Hierdoor<br />
wordt de kaart zeer onoverzichtelijk wordt naar mate er meer variabel<strong>en</strong> kom<strong>en</strong>. We kunn<strong>en</strong> werk<strong>en</strong><br />
met spiegeling spiegeling van de kaart<strong>en</strong> of door gewoon de kaart<strong>en</strong> te herhal<strong>en</strong> herhal<strong>en</strong> <strong>en</strong> de meest beduid<strong>en</strong>de bit te<br />
verander<strong>en</strong> (overal 16 optell<strong>en</strong>).<br />
Gespiegelde Gespiegelde kaart<strong>en</strong> Herhaalde kaart<strong>en</strong><br />
Het invull<strong>en</strong> invull<strong>en</strong> van de Karnaugkaart gebeurt met de<br />
waarheidstabel waarheidstabel : elk vakje komt overe<strong>en</strong> met e<strong>en</strong> rij in de<br />
waarheidtabel. We vull<strong>en</strong> gewoon de uitkomst van de functie in<br />
e<strong>en</strong> bepaalde rij in in het overe<strong>en</strong>komstige vakje.<br />
Minimale oplossing<strong>en</strong> oplossing<strong>en</strong> voor de booleaanse functie vind<strong>en</strong> we dan door zo<br />
groot groot mogelijke mogelijke mogelijke aane<strong>en</strong>sluit<strong>en</strong>de aane<strong>en</strong>sluit<strong>en</strong>de gebied<strong>en</strong> gebied<strong>en</strong> gebied<strong>en</strong> met oppervlakte macht<strong>en</strong> van 2<br />
met dezelfde waarde te selecter<strong>en</strong> <strong>en</strong> de overe<strong>en</strong>komstige variabel<strong>en</strong> te<br />
combiner<strong>en</strong>. Hiervoor zijn verschill<strong>en</strong>de mogelijkhed<strong>en</strong>.<br />
Bv. F = x’y’z’w’ + x’yz’w + x’yzw + xy’z’w’ + xy’zw’ + xyz’w + xyzw<br />
E<strong>en</strong> minimale oplossing daarvoor is yw + xy’w’ + y’z’w’<br />
2) ) Minimalisering Minimalisering met Karnaugh Karnaugh-kaart<br />
Karnaugh<br />
kaart<br />
Minimale Minimale AND AND-OR AND OR realisatie realisatie<br />
Minimalisatie Minimalisatie van booleaanse functie tot AND AND-OR AND<br />
OR implem<strong>en</strong>tatie :<br />
1) Karnaugh Karnaugh-kaart Karnaugh kaart kaart opstell<strong>en</strong> :<br />
Vanuit de de canonische vorm of de waarheidtabel :<br />
- voor elke 1 in de waarheidstabel zett<strong>en</strong> we<br />
e<strong>en</strong> 1 in de karnaughkaart<br />
- ook elke don’t care (wanneer het niet uitmaakt<br />
of de uitgang 0 of 1 is omdat de ingangcombinatie<br />
toch niet voorkomt) gev<strong>en</strong> we weer met e<strong>en</strong> kruis<br />
- de 0<strong>en</strong> zijn niet niet belangrijk<br />
belangrijk